stridulent
/strɪˈdjuːlənt/Definitions
1. adjective
Having or producing a harsh, grating sound, especially of a high pitch.
“The stridulent song of the cicadas filled the air on that summer evening.”
2. noun
A harsh, grating sound, especially of a high pitch.
“The stridulent noise from the construction site was disturbing the neighborhood.”